Section 2. Sewerage of electricity Conductors with voltage up to 35 kV. Conductors with voltage up to 1 kV Encyclopedia of radio electronics and electrical engineering / Rules for the installation of electrical installations (PUE) 2.2.19. Branch points from current conductors must be accessible for maintenance. 2.2.20. In industrial premises, current conductors of IP00 performance should be located at a height of at least 3,5 m from the floor level or service platform, and current conductors of performance up to IP31 - at least 2,5 m. Installation height of IP20 and higher performance conductors with insulated busbars, as well as IP40 and higher performance conductors is not standardized. The height of the installation of conductors of any design at a mains voltage of 42 V and below AC and 110 V and below DC is also not standardized. In rooms visited only by qualified service personnel (for example, in the technical floors of buildings, etc.). installation height of conductors IP20 and higher is not standardized. In electrical rooms of industrial enterprises, the installation height of current conductors of IP00 and higher performance is not standardized. Places where accidental contact with conductors of IP00 version is possible must be protected. Conductors must have additional protection in places where mechanical damage is possible. Conductors and fences placed above the walkways must be installed at a height of at least 1,9 m from the floor or service platform. Mesh fencing of conductors must have a mesh with cells no larger than 25 x 25 mm. The structures on which the conductors are installed must be made of non-combustible materials and have a fire resistance limit of at least 0,25 hours. Nodes for the passage of conductors through ceilings, partitions and walls should exclude the possibility of the spread of flame and smoke from one room to another. 2.2.21. The distance from the current-carrying parts of current conductors without sheaths (IP00 version) to pipelines must be at least 1 m, and to process equipment - at least 1,5 m. The distance from bus ducts with sheaths (IP21; IP31, IP51, IP65) to pipelines and process equipment is not standardized. 2.2.22. The clear distance between the conductors of different phases or poles of conductors without sheaths (IP00) and from them to the walls of buildings and grounded structures must be at least 50 mm, and to combustible elements of buildings - at least 200 mm. 2.2.23. Switching and protective equipment for branches from current conductors must be installed directly on the current conductors or near the branch point (see also 3.1.16). This apparatus shall be so located and guarded as to prevent accidental contact with live parts. Appropriate devices (rods, cables) must be provided for operational control from the floor level or service platform by devices installed at an inaccessible height. Apparatuses must have features distinguishable from the floor or service platform indicating the position of the apparatus (on, off). 2.2.24. For conductors, insulators made of fireproof materials (porcelain, steatite, etc.) should be used. 2.2.25. Along the entire route of current conductors without protective sheaths (IP00) every 10-15 m, as well as in places visited by people (landing sites for crane operators, etc.), safety warning posters should be fixed. 2.2.26. Measures (for example, insulating spacers) should be provided to prevent unacceptable convergence of the phase conductors between themselves and with the conductor sheath during the passage of short-circuit currents. 2.2.27. The following additional requirements apply to conductors in crane spans: 1. Unshielded conductors without protective sheaths (IP00) laid along trusses should be placed at a height of at least 2,5 m from the level of the bridge deck and the crane trolley; when laying current conductors below 2,5 m, but not below the level of the lower chord of the floor truss, guards should be provided to prevent accidental contact with them from the bridge deck and the crane trolley along the entire length of the current conductors. It is allowed to install a fence in the form of a canopy on the crane itself under the conductor. 2. Sections of current conductors without protective sheaths (IP00) above repair pens for cranes (see 5.4.16) must have guards to prevent contact with live parts from the deck of the crane trolley. Fencing is not required if the current conductor is located above this flooring at a level of at least 2,5 m or if insulated conductors are used in these places; in the latter case, the smallest distance to them is determined based on the repair conditions. 3. Laying of conductors under the crane without the use of special measures of protection against mechanical damage is allowed in the dead zone of the crane. Special protection measures against mechanical damage are not required for sheathed busbars of any design for current up to 630 A, located near the process equipment outside the dead zone of the crane.
